A Senate subcommittee has opened an investigation into Roblox over child safety.
“Roblox appears to prioritize revenue and engagement metrics over the safety and well-being of our children, and the alleged criminal activity on Roblox warrants congressional scrutiny,” Senators Josh Hawley (R-MO) and Dick Durbin (D-IL) wrote in a letter to Roblox CEO David Baszucki. The online gaming platform has also been subject to state lawsuits regarding alleged child safety issues. Roblox has settled some of those lawsuits, and it recently launched dedicated accounts for younger users.
